MACON, Georgia (41NBC/WMGT) – The 567 Center for Renewal is hosting Kool-Aid and Canvas on August 24. The event is an opportunity for children ages 6-12 to create a painting with acrylic paints on canvas.
Art instructor, Dee Washington, says painting is a time to focus on yourself and do something you enjoy. Washington says the art center offers various art classes throughout the month.
Washington says students will learn a variety of painting techniques to inspire them in their own creative endeavors.
Parents can drop-off their child and pick them up when class is over, or they can sign up to paint along with their child.
The workshop is $20 and will be from 10:30 a.m. to 12 p.m.
